"Pilot Getaways" magazine made reference to a landing strip in Death
Valley. I can't find it on my charts. The name is "Chicken Strip" and
is within the park boundries. Does anyone have information on this
strip?


It's in Saline Valley, the next valley over to the west. I think
it isn't serviceable since the Park service took over from
the BLM. I've seen people land there. It gets its name from
the impossibility of doing a go-around. I cant find it in the
"Abandoned & Little-known airfields".

It was/is used for access to the hot springs in Saline Valley, but
I've not been there for 10 years.
